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47275211 9183 61266 06978978
2278 373409
2278 373409
0484698 71483 836719 8595161 35
All about undefined
Interested in learning more?
2278 373409
0484698 71483 836719 8595161 35
See more
3291462 931
6482 324494 95
See more
842624 62299
35271 91523 30525923 633561763
See more